The roasted borettane onions in an air fryer are a truly exquisite side dish. You can prepare them in a thousand ways (sweet and sour, baked, caramelized, gratin, stewed, in sauce) but have you ever tried them roasted? Very few ingredients and a quick preparation because the onions are already cleaned and peeled, ready to cook. And since roasted onions tend to dry out a bit, I suggest adding some onion distillate, a gourmet condiment with a strong flavor and intense aroma that will be a special boost to the roasted borettane onions.

Ingredients
- 1.5 cups borettane onions
- 2 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
- to taste salt
- 2 tablespoons onion distillate
Tools
- 1 Bowl
- 1 Air Fryer
- 1 Baking Dish
Steps
Clean the onions by removing the outermost layer and roots if present. Transfer them to a bowl and season with oil and salt. Arrange them in a baking dish that is suitable for the air fryer, if you have the oven type, or directly in the basket and cook at 392°F for 40 minutes if you want them softer or for 25/30 minutes if you like them crispy. Once ready, let them cool down a bit and finish with the onion distillate before serving at the table.
